job依赖的jar_51CTO博客
1.mavenjar包依赖规则1.间接依赖路径最短优先 一个项目依赖了a和b两个jar包。其中a-b-c1.0 , d-e-f-c1.1 。由于c1.0路径最短,所以项目最后使用jar是c1.0。2.pom文件中申明顺序优先 有人就问了如果 a-b-c1.0 , d-e-c1.1 这样路径都一样怎么办?其实maven作者也没那么傻,会以在pom文件中申明顺序那选,如果pom文件中先申明了d再
1.生成jar包:sh hello.jar jar.sh [chenquan@hostuser tartest]$ cat jar.sh jar -cvf0m ${1} ./META-INF/MANIFEST.MF . [chenquan@hostuser tartest]$ ls META-INF/ MANIFEST.MF
转载 2023-06-22 23:58:41
155阅读
spring 3.0版本以上jar包使用以及依赖关系 spring.jar是包含有完整发布单个jar包,spring.jar中包含除了 spring-mock.jar里所包含内容外其它所有jar内容,因为只有在开发环境下才会用到spring-mock.jar来进行辅助测试,正式应用系统中是用不得这些类。   除了spring.jar文件
转载 2023-07-15 19:48:31
174阅读
 Flink技术解析:依赖库未正确安装或更新引发问题及解决方案  一、引言 Apache Flink,作为一款开源流处理框架,以其强大实时计算能力与高可扩展性在大数据领域广受欢迎。然而,在实际做开发和运维时候,如果Flink或者它所依赖一些库没有装好,或者更新得不恰当,就很可能在运行过程中冒出各种各样错误,这样一来,系统稳定性和性能自然就会大受影响啦。本文将深入探
在Linux环境中,使用jar文件管理依赖jar是一个常见操作。在项目开发过程中,我们经常会遇到需要引入其他jar包来满足项目的需求。而在Linux上,特别是在使用红帽系列操作系统时,我们需要特别关注如何管理这些依赖jar包,以保证项目的稳定性和可靠性。 当我们在项目中引入一个新jar包时,除了将其放置在项目的classpath下,还需要在项目的构建工具中进行配置。在Linux环境下,使用
最近在搞一些漏洞jar包升级,包括springboot、cloud等依赖,期间遇到了一些小坑,特此做这个记录一下。 目录1. 打印/获取该项目的依赖树2.判断依赖是否有漏洞3.版本兼容性查询4.常规依赖版本升级5.依赖升级5.1 jackson升级5.2 spring相关依赖、springboot、webflux依赖升级(无cloud)5.3 spring、springboot、springclo
右键项目->Properties->Java Build Path(左侧菜单)->选择Libraries有两种方式,导入JAR包实际上就是建立一种链接,并不是COPY式导入一、导入外部包,Add External JARs...,这种只是与JAR绝对路径建立链接,并不会拷贝到项目中。二、导入包,Add JARs...,这种需
转载 2023-05-26 15:50:03
797阅读
文章目录背景解决思路实践总结 背景有这样一种情况,如果是java -jar xx.jar这种情况,通常我们逻辑是会把所有的jar包放在一起,这样打包,这个会存在一种情况,就是打包下来非常大,由于程序要传到服务器上执行,大概率会多次修改,这样会很浪费时间在打包,上传过程解决思路把依赖包打在一起,这部分代码基本不会动,只传一次上去,然后打包业务jar时候,不打依赖,那这样的话,问题不就解决了吗
转载 2023-06-13 22:39:24
372阅读
一、前言JAXB——Java Architecture for XML Binding,是一项可以根据XML Schema产生Java类技术。JAXB提供将XML实例文档反向生成Java对象树方法,也能将Java对象树内容重新写到XML实例文档。 二、JAXB相关class和interface(1)JAXBContext。  JAXBContext类提供到 JAXB A
转载 2023-07-07 14:01:46
177阅读
在原本代码中已经使用了OKHTTP和rxjava,然后今天依赖retrofit时候一直报错Program type already present: okhttp3.internal.ws.RealWebSocket$1.class说是我重复添加了OKHTTP包,但其实我直接把OKHTTP依赖注释掉都没用,只要依赖retrofit相关就一定报这个错网上推荐添加以下配置,但我尝试后无效,你
Spring 依赖Jar包简介 Spring依赖关系依赖关系分组JAR文件说 明aopallianceaopalliance.jarAOP Alliance(http://aopalliance.sourceforge.net/) 是个联合开源协作组织,在多个项目间进行协作以期提供一套标准AOP Java接口(interface)。 Spring AOP就是基于AOP Alliance标准
将jxl.jar拷贝到"%JREHOME%\lib\ext"目录下。 jxl.jar Installation JExcelApi comes packaged as a zipped tar file, called something like jexcelapi_2_0.tar.gz. To unpack on UNIX systems, at the command
java -jar/-cp启动添加外部依赖包 启动java主要有两种方式,分别为:java -jar test.jar、java -cp/-classpath test.jar com.main.Test。然后分别讲一下这两种方式启动程序时,如何加载外部依赖包。为了方便大家理解,首先说一下JavaClassLoader。ClassLoader具体作用就是将class文件加载到jvm虚拟机
转载 2023-07-15 19:48:40
187阅读
## JavaCSV依赖Jar包介绍 在Java开发中,处理CSV(逗号分隔值)文件是一种常见需求。JavaCSV是一个流行Java库,用于读取和写入CSV文件。为了使用JavaCSV,我们需要将它依赖jar包添加到项目中。 ### JavaCSV依赖jar包 JavaCSV库依赖以下两个jar包: 1. **javacsv.jar**:JavaCSV库主要jar包,包含了CS
原创 6月前
96阅读
自从工作以来一直都是从事于J2EE方面的项目开发工作,市场上J2EE框架至少也有十几种吧,像Struts、Spring、Hibernate、Ibatis这类框架是用最多,因为比较成熟、合理而且还有专门团队维护升级工作,最重要是他们是开源且免费,能快速、安全开发项目。虽然现在SSH、SSI框架大家都知道,但我相信架构出来项目框架有很多种。原因就是Struts、Spring、Hiber
jxl是一个韩国人写java操作excel工具, 在开源世界中,有两套比较有影响API可供使用,一个是POI,一个是jExcelAPI,,功能相对POI比较弱一点。但jExcelAPI对中文支持非常好,API是纯Java, 并不依赖Windows系统,即使运行在Linux下,它同样能够正确处理Excel文件。 另外需要说明是,这套API对图形和图表支持很
# JavaCompiler 依赖jar科普与使用指南 Java是一种广泛使用编程语言,其强大跨平台特性和丰富生态系统使得它在软件开发领域占据着重要地位。在Java开发过程中,Java编译器(JavaCompiler)是一个不可或缺工具。本文将介绍JavaCompiler依赖jar包,并通过代码示例展示如何使用JavaCompiler进行Java代码编译。 ## JavaCom
原创 3月前
15阅读
1.jar包冲突背景?我们在maven项目中会通过坐标来引入jar包,而maven本身有个依赖传递特性,就是说我们使用坐标引入A,而A又依赖了B,这时候我们无需在pom.xml文件中显示引入B,因为B会根据maven依赖传递特性自动引入。maven依赖传递特性,例如:A-依赖->B(1.0版本)C-依赖->D-依赖->B(2.0版本)这种场景下,maven会把A、C、D
转载 2023-11-25 20:44:32
363阅读
一、介绍maven提供打包插件有如下三种:pluginfunctionmaven-jar-pluginmaven 默认打包插件,用来创建 project jarmaven-shade-plugin用来打可执行包,executable(fat) jarmaven-assembly-plugin支持定制化打包方式,例如 apache 项目的打包方式打包准备: 需要确定依赖scope。默认
1. 起源spark类加载及参数传递过程还是很复杂,主要是因为他运行环境太复杂了,不同集群管理器完全不一样,即使是同一集群管理器cluster和client也不一样,再加上这块探究还是需要一定java功底和耐心,会使得很多人望而却步。下图是yarn-cluster模式参数传递过程:下图是yarn-client模式参数传递过程:但是java代码,尤其是整合框架,公司大了假如没有统
  • 1
  • 2
  • 3
  • 4
  • 5